Abstract
The better way for Web services discovery is to classify the Web services into different categories when they are published in a registry. The method of intelligent clustering based classification of the Web services is mainly studied. A hybrid solution is proposed for building and populating a taxonomy structure by combining human knowledge with the techniques of artificial intelligence. The Web service is converted into standard vector format through Web service description language (WSDL) document. The self-organizing neural network based learning algorithm and clustering algorithm are designed and implemented to classify the Web services automatically.
